Heard of this West Coast, Left Coast Festival? It's a three-week event happening with the LA Phil showcasing California as a land of inspiration. It starts this Saturday, thanks to composer John Adams, composer of Pulizer prize-winning music, writer of a blog and a memoir, and beneficiary of abundant California sunshine.
